Flash Memory Programming Basics
frank

This short video shows how you can use the Cheetah SPI Host Adapter with the Flash Center Software to quickly program an SPI Flash memory chip in less than 25 seconds!  The Flash Center software can support virtually any memory part, gang-program devices in parallel, and easily verify the contents on the memory chip.

The Cheetah adapter is a general purpose SPI master that communicates at speeds of up to 40+ MHz. It can be used to interface with SPI peripherals and program SPI-based flash memories and EEPROMs.

The Flash Center software is free and works with both the Cheetah adapter and the Aardvark I2C/SPI Host Adapter. The software has built-in support for most major I2C- and SPI-based memories, allowing users to quickly and easily program their part, in-system or standalone.
